So you will be able to bring all of the following for the adapter:
Dual Adapter Parts List:
21 Spline coupler
Adapter plate with bearings installed
Bearing spacer
11 Studs and nuts
Drain plug
Rear transmission output seal
2.28 Shift knob
Snap Ring
Shifter keystock
Detent plug
Three paper gaskets
I have most of the tools for the install except for a 30mm socket, gear puller, 3/16 Diameter Pin Punch and snap ring pliers
